Keeping Your Windows Clean This Spring

1. Clean Your Window Screens

If you live in an area that sees a lot of snowfall, then you probably took down your window screens during this last winter. Now that it is time to put them back up again, you might as well give them a good cleaning. Take a non-abrasive brush and household cleaner, and give it a good scrubbing. Hose down both sides, and let them dry properly before reinstalling them.

2. Clean Both Inside and Out

A lot of people only clean the interior portion of their windows since it is easier to access. Whether you have double-hung windows or large picture windows, cleaning the outside is just as important as cleaning the inside, maybe even more so since the outside portion of your windows will usually have more stubborn stains like bird droppings and water spots.

3. Make Your Own Cleaning Solution

A lot of commercial window cleaning solutions contain harsh chemicals that might actually do more harm than good. Thankfully, you can easily make your own window cleaner using items you probably already have. To make your own window cleaner, combine two cups of water with a quarter cup of white vinegar and half a tablespoon of dishwashing liquid, and give it a good shake.
